This SAE Aerospace Recommended Practice (ARP) provides guidance in the design, development, qualification test, process control and production acceptance test for flight critical control valve (FCCV) design used in military flight control servoactuators where loss of single valve control could cause a catastrophic failure resulting in death, permanent total disability, and/or financial loss exceeding a defined contractual limit. The FCCV, which is one element of a flight control actuator servo control loop, is a variable position control valve which modulates fluid into and out of the servoactuator power stage cylinders. The FCCV may be mechanically driven

This document has been declared "Stabilized" and will no longer be subjected to periodic reviews for currency. Users are responsible for verifying references and continued suitability or technical requirements. New technology may exist. The technical architecture defined in this document outlines mandatory, emerging, and needed standards to provide interoperability at key interfaces in the aircraft/store system (including an associated NATO Network Enabled Capability environment), as required to support a future plug-and-play aircraft/store integration capability. These standards relate to services and protocols associated with the subject interfaces. Modeling standards to facilitate the Model Driven Architecture\sR (MDA\sR) approach to system definition and implementation are also included. Note that the status of referenced standards as reflected in this document is as of August 2007, and document users should check to see if there has been a subsequent change of status relative to applicable standards. The purpose of this document is to define the technical architecture for the NATO Aircraft, Launcher, and Weapon Interoperability - Common Interface (ALWI-CI) environment for aircraft/weapon integration. It was developed by NATO Industrial Advisory Group (NIAG) Subgroup 97 in response to direction from the NAFAG Air Group 2, with technical support from the Society of Automotive Engineers (SAE) Aerospace Avionic Systems Division, to facilitate an interoperable plug-and-play integration capability for aircraft, launchers, and weapons across NATO airpower. The field of application for the ALWI Technical Architecture is NATO aircraft, carriage devices (launchers, carriage devices, etc.), stores (weapons, pods, etc.), and other systems/subsystems which support store employment (communication networks, mission planning systems, etc.)

The purpose of this standard practice is to provide the minimum requirements for the conduct of compliance audits. The intended use of standard is to provide a basis for an internal or external entity to develop an audit program. An audit program defines specific requirements for the execution of audits for a particular objective. An example of an audit program would be an external (third party) audit of LSA manufacturer’s quality assurance system. Compliance to this standard would insure that audit programs and those who develop and execute them are following a consensus set of minimum requirements. This standard does not mandate either internal or external audits. An auditing entity cannot request or approve an audit. Other Audit Criteria8212;Other audit criteria may be included in the audit scope if specified in the audit plan. Examples include safety, technical, operational, and management requirements. Items that are outside the scope of auditable criteria may be submitted as observations for possible resolution. However these are not binding and are not mandatory. Additional Services8212;Additional services are outside the scope of an audit objective. Examples of such services are consultation to resolve negative or open findings or any other service where the auditing entity conducts an activity other than an audit for the audited entity. Compliance Assurance8212;An audit is only an indicator of the compliance health of the facility and/or organization during only the period under review and therefore has limited compliance assurance and is not assumed to be exhaustive. Level of Review is Variable8212;The audit scope may vary to meet different audit objectives. For example, the audit scope may include only selected audit criteria, selected period under review, or selected portions of a facility or organization.1.1 This standard practice establishes the minimum set of requirements for auditing programs, methods, and systems, the responsibilities for all parties involved, and qualifications for entities conducting audits against ASTM standards on Light Sport Aircraft. 1.2 This standard provides requirements to enable consistent and structured examination of objective evidence for compliance that is beneficial for the LSA industry and its consumers. 1.1 This specification covers airworthiness requirements for the design of a powered or non-powered fixed wing light sport aircraft, a “glider.” 1.2 This specification is applicable to the design of a light sport aircraft glider as defined by regulations and limited to day VFR flight. 1.3 A glider for the purposes of this specification is defined as a heavier than air aircraft that remains airborne through the dynamic reaction of the air with a fixed wing and in which the ability to remain aloft in free flight does not depend on the propulsion from a power plant. A powered glider is defined for the purposes of this specification as a glider equipped with a power plant in which the flight characteristics are those of a glider when the power plant is not in operation. 1.4 The values in SI units are to be regarded as the standard. The values in parenthesis are for information only. 1.5 This standard does not purport to address all of the safety concerns, if any, associated with its use. This Society of Automotive Engineers (SAE) Aerospace Standard (AS) Annex defines Minimum Performance Standards (MPS), qualification requirements, and minimum documentation requirements for side-facing seats in civil rotorcraft, transport aircraft, and general aviation aircraft. The goal is to define test and evaluation criteria to demonstrate occupant protection when a single-occupant side-facing seat/occupant/restraint system is subjected to statically applied ultimate loads and to dynamic test conditions set forth in the applicable 14,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) Part 23, 25, 27 or 29. While this Annex addresses system performance, responsibility for the seating system is divided between the seat supplier and the installation applicant. The seat supplier's responsibility consists of meeting all the seat system performance requirements and obtaining and supplying to the installation applicant all the data prescribed by this document. The installation applicant has the final responsibility in assuring that all requirements for safe seat installation have been met. This document addresses the performance criteria for single occupant side-facing seat systems requiring dynamic testing to be used in civil rotorcraft, transport aircraft, and general aviation aircraft. This document covers passenger seats for use in aircraft type-certificated as defined in AS8049 section 1.3.
